Structural Expert

Hitachi · Remote, Jihomoravský kraj, Czech Republic, CZ · 1 day ago

Join us and help shape the future of structural engineering for High Voltage products.

We are looking for an experienced Structural Expert who will play a key role in driving global engineering standards, developing tools and processes, and supporting innovation across our international organization. In this position, you will collaborate with engineering experts around the world, influence the way we design and deliver our products, and contribute to the continuous improvement of our global engineering practices.

Your responsibilities

Collaborate with Structural Engineering teams globally to establish and promote unified design methodologies and engineering best practices.

Drive innovation in High Voltage products through close cooperation with R&D on the design, testing, and continuous enhancement of support structures and systems.

Identify opportunities for process improvements and lead initiatives that increase efficiency, quality, and consistency across engineering activities.

Develop and implement engineering guidelines, work instructions, templates, and standards to support global knowledge sharing and standardization.

Support the development of engineering tools and systems and drive the adoption of automation solutions that improve productivity and accuracy.

Define requirements for newly developed structural components and support related approval and compliance processes.

Act as a key interface between R&D, Engineering, Production, and Installation teams to ensure successful implementation of improvements and changes.

Lead and develop the global Structural Expert Community, fostering collaboration and knowledge sharing across the organization.

Apply Lean principles and continuous improvement methodologies to optimize workflows and engineering processes.

Your background

Master’s degree in Structural, Civil, or Mechanical Engineering.

10+ years of experience in structural engineering or a related technical field.

Recognized technical expertise and strong understanding of structural engineering principles.

Experience with engineering tools such as Tekla, STAAD, and Ansys.

Strong knowledge of structural steel design standards and codes, including EN standards, Eurocode, and IBC.

Experience with High Voltage Switchgear products and supporting steel structures is considered a strong advantage.

Strong communication and stakeholder management skills with the ability to influence and collaborate across global teams.

Fluent English, both written and spoken.
